On Tuesday, 19 February 2013 at 01:09:06 UTC, Ali Çehreli wrote: [...] > How about an OO solution? That looks awesome. :) I'll have a play with it and see if I can bend it to my will. Thanks for the help. Like I said, I'm a bit of a noob, so a push in a more suitable direction is always appreciated. :) Regards Brian